| /** | |
| * Whether to convert the function and parameter names in to snake case for tool calling. | |
| * | |
| * Kotlin idiomatic style uses camelCase for names. However, many large language models are | |
| * predominantly trained on datasets where snake_case is common. | |
| * | |
| * By default, this API converts Kotlin camelCase names to snake_case to potentially improve tool | |
| * calling performance with models more familiar with snake_case. | |
| * | |
| * While the choice between snake_case and camelCase often has minimal impact, it can be | |
| * significant for smaller, fine-tuned models that were trained exclusively with one convention. | |
| * | |
| * Set this flag to `false` if your model is specifically trained with camelCase tool descriptions | |
| * to skip the conversion. Otherwise, the default of `true` (using snake_case) is recommended. | |
| * | |
| * Note: This flag is read only when a new [Conversation] is created. Changing this value will not | |
| * affect any existing [Conversation] instances. | |
| */ | |
| var convertCamelToSnakeCaseInToolDescription: Boolean = true | |
